      Meaning of the first name
      Aimerey

      Origin 
      Likely English or Invented Name

      Meaning 
      Possibly A Variation of Amory or Aimery

      Variations 
      Aimery, Amerey, Aimeric

      The name Aimerey is likely of English origin and can be considered an invented name or a variation of the more traditional names Amory or Aimery. It combines elements that convey strength and courage, which are common attributes associated with its root names. Although not widely used, it possesses a unique and contemporary appeal, making it stand out in a crowded field of names.

      Historically, the names Amory and Aimery have roots that trace back to Old German, with connotations tied to bravery and power. These names were more prominent in medieval Europe, appearing in various historical texts and records. Over time, the variations like Aimerey have emerged, reflecting the evolution of language and naming conventions. While not as firmly established as its predecessors, Aimerey carries the weight of history through its connections to beloved traditional names.
